Man held over cannabis farm raid in Govan area of Glasgow
A man has been arrested after hundreds of cannabis plants were found at a property in Glasgow.
Officers acting under warrant raided the address in Copland Road, Govan, at about 07:30 on Thursday.
It is understood that up to 400 plants were found, with a potential street value of £150,000.
Strathclyde Police said that a 45-year-old man had been arrested in connection with the find. A report will be submitted to the procurator fiscal.
